Anjel Perumal Temple

Tirunelveli,TN,India

Photo: alanbatt

About Anjel Perumal Temple:

Anjel Perumal Temple located at Tirunelveli in Tamil Nadu state

Featured

Other Temples to Visit

Special Offers

Top Tour Packages

Leave a comment